Jammu and Kashmir Lieutenant Governor Manoj Sinha unveiled '
Mission YUVA
' on Sunday, an ambitious initiative designed to establish the region as a center of
entrepreneurial excellence
and
employment generation
. Addressing an official Republic Day function, Sinha announced the creation of over 1,37,000 enterprises and 4,25,000 jobs within five years.
"Mission YUVA is a transformative strategy that leverages the region's socio-economic and cultural heritage for inclusive prosperity," Sinha said.
Sinha emphasized transparent recruitment, citing 40,000 appointments in the last five years. With 10,616 positions referred to the Public Service Commission and Services Selection Board, notifications for 7,376 have been issued. Examinations for 6,090 positions have already taken place.
For
skill development
, initiatives under Himayat, National Urban Livelihood Mission, and National Rural Livelihood Mission are providing self-employment opportunities.
"The Khel Gaon in Nagrota, a multi-sports hub, will soon be completed, and a gymnastics academy will be established in Srinagar," Sinha said.
With a focus on economic and social empowerment, 'Mission YUVA' aims to redefine Jammu and Kashmir’s developmental trajectory.
